Practicality, passive performance and a tethered connection with nature. The strawbale “earth” house; born out of a sustainability conscious & pragmatic client brief.

A low lying floor plane anchors the occupants to the ground, providing a strong connection with the earth, vertically speaking. Externally thick solid walls surround, encompassing inhabitants in a heavy robust shelter.

The brief was simple and so too was the philosophy for the design; and what was produced was a building of grounded-ness, stability and stillness.
